Buyers Guide

Buying an ammo safe is an important investment in both your firearms and your family’s safety. To help you make an informed purchase, here are some key factors to consider when shopping for the best ammo safe:

  1. Size and Capacity: Ammo safes come in various sizes and capacities to fit different needs. Consider the amount of ammunition you own and whether you plan on adding more in the future. It’s important to choose a safe that can accommodate your current needs and allow room for growth.
  2. Security Features: Look for a safe with a sturdy steel construction and a locking mechanism that suits your needs. Biometric safes use fingerprints, combination locks require a code, and key locks use traditional keys. Decide which option is best for your preferences and lifestyle.
  3. Fireproof and Waterproof Capabilities: In the event of a fire or flood, an ammo safe with fireproof and waterproof capabilities can save your firearms and ammunition. Look for a safe with a UL rating of at least 1 hour for fire resistance and a waterproof seal to prevent water damage.
  4. Price: Ammo safes can range from a few hundred to thousands of dollars. Determine your budget and look for safes that meet your needs while staying within your price range. Remember that investing in a high-quality ammo safe is a long-term investment in the protection of your firearms.
  5. Reviews and Ratings: Read reviews from other gun owners and experts to get an idea of the quality and reliability of different ammo safes. Consider feedback on durability, ease of use, and customer support before making your purchase.

By considering these factors when shopping for the best ammo safe, you can ensure that you are investing in a secure and reliable option that will protect your ammunition for years to come.

Types of Ammo Safes

There are several types of ammo safes on the market, each with its own unique features and benefits. Here are the most common types of ammo safes:

  1. Biometric Ammo Safes: Biometric ammo safes use fingerprints to unlock the safe. This technology provides quick and easy access to your ammunition in case of an emergency, while also keeping your ammunition secure. Biometric safes can be more expensive than other options, but they offer a high level of security and convenience.
  2. Combination Lock Ammo Safes: Combination lock ammo safes require a code to open the safe. This option is reliable and can be more affordable than biometric safes. You can change the code as often as needed to ensure maximum security.
  3. Key Lock Ammo Safes: Key lock ammo safes use traditional keys to lock and unlock the safe. This option can be reliable, but it’s important to keep the key in a secure location to prevent unauthorized access. Key lock safes can be more affordable than biometric or combination lock options.
  4. Portable Ammo Safes: Portable ammo safes are lightweight and easy to transport. These safes can be used for traveling or taking your ammunition to the range. They may not offer the same level of security as a full-size safe, but they provide convenience and flexibility.

Care and Maintenance

Proper care and maintenance of your ammo safe will help ensure its longevity and continued effectiveness in protecting your ammunition. Here are some tips for caring for and maintaining your ammo safe: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Dust, debris, and moisture can accumulate inside your safe over time. Regularly clean the interior of your safe with a soft, dry cloth to remove any buildup. Avoid using water or chemicals that can damage your safe.
  2. Lubrication: Keeping your locking mechanism lubricated will ensure smooth and reliable operation. Use a silicone-based lubricant and apply it sparingly to avoid buildup.
  3. Inspections: Regularly inspect your safe for signs of damage or wear. Check the locking mechanism, hinges, and door seal for any cracks or breaks. If you notice any issues, contact the manufacturer or a professional safe technician for repair or maintenance.
  4. Humidity Control: High humidity levels can cause damage to your ammunition and safe. Consider using a dehumidifier or desiccant packs to control humidity levels within your safe. These items can be purchased separately or may be included with your safe.
  5. Avoid Overloading: Overloading your safe with ammunition can cause stress on the hinges, locking mechanism, and door seal. Be sure to follow the manufacturer’s recommended capacity for your specific safe.

By following these tips for care and maintenance, you can help ensure that your ammo safe remains effective and reliable for years to come. Regular cleaning, lubrication, inspections, humidity control, and avoiding overloading are all important steps to take in maintaining your ammo safe.

Tips and Tricks

In addition to proper care and maintenance, there are several tips and tricks that can help you get the most out of your ammo safe. Here are some tips to consider:

  1. Organize Your Ammunition: Organizing your ammunition inside your safe can help you easily find what you need and prevent clutter. Consider using labels, dividers, or trays to help organize your ammunition by caliber, brand, or type.
  2. Use Anchor Bolts: Securing your safe to the floor or wall using anchor bolts can add an extra level of security. Anchor bolts make it more difficult for thieves to remove the safe from your home or office.
  3. Keep Backup Keys: If your safe uses a key lock, it’s important to keep backup keys in a secure location. Consider giving a backup key to a trusted family member or friend in case of an emergency.
  4. Practice Safe Gun Handling: Always handle firearms and ammunition safely, even when stored in a safe. Keep your firearms unloaded and locked in the safe, and only handle them when necessary.
  5. Consider a Security System: Installing a security system in your home or office can provide an additional layer of protection for your ammunition safe. A security system can alert you and the authorities if someone tries to break into your safe or home.

Cheap vs Expensive

When it comes to ammo safes, there is a wide range of prices available. It can be tempting to opt for a cheaper option, but it’s important to consider the differences between cheap and expensive safes. Cheap ammo safes may be more affordable upfront, but they may not offer the same level of security and protection as more expensive options. Here are some differences to consider:

  1. Build Quality: Expensive ammo safes are typically made with high-quality materials and construction, such as thick steel and advanced locking mechanisms. Cheaper safes may be made with lower quality materials that can be easier to break into.
  2. Security Features: Expensive ammo safes often come with advanced security features, such as biometric locks, multiple locking bolts, and drill-resistant steel. Cheaper safes may have basic locks or minimal security features.
  3. Capacity: Expensive ammo safes often have larger capacities, allowing you to store more ammunition and firearms. Cheaper safes may have smaller capacities, limiting the amount of ammunition you can store.
  4. Longevity: Expensive ammo safes are often built to last and come with long warranties. Cheaper safes may not have the same longevity or durability, requiring more frequent replacement.

Ultimately, the choice between a cheap and expensive ammo safe depends on your individual needs and budget. While a cheaper option may be tempting, investing in a high-quality, more expensive safe can provide greater security and protection for your ammunition and firearms. Consider the differences in build quality, security features, capacity, and longevity when making your decision.

Alternatives to Ammo Safes

While ammo safes are a great way to store and protect your ammunition, there are also several alternatives to consider. Here are some alternatives to ammo safes:

  1. Gun Cabinets: Gun cabinets are a popular alternative to ammo safes, especially for those with a smaller collection of firearms and ammunition. Gun cabinets are typically made with wood or metal and feature locking mechanisms to keep your firearms and ammunition secure.
  2. Hidden Compartments: Another alternative to ammo safes is to create hidden compartments within your home or office. These compartments can be made with a variety of materials and can be hidden in plain sight, such as behind a picture frame or inside a piece of furniture.
  3. Lockable Containers: Lockable containers, such as metal toolboxes or plastic storage containers, can also be used to store and protect your ammunition. These containers can be locked with a padlock or combination lock for added security.
  4. Home Safes: If you already have a home safe for storing valuables, you may also consider using it to store your ammunition. Be sure to check the weight capacity of your safe and the type of items it’s designed to protect before using it to store ammunition.

When considering alternatives to ammo safes, it’s important to prioritize security and protection for your ammunition. Gun cabinets, hidden compartments, lockable containers, and home safes can all provide a level of security and protection, but they may not offer the same level of security as a high-quality ammo safe. Be sure to weigh the pros and cons of each option before making your decision.
